back to Satellite Product List Product DescriptionThe Tri-Decadal Global Landsat Orthorectified data collection consists of a global set of high-quality, relatively cloud-free orthorectified MSS, TM and ETM+ imagery from Landsats 1-5 and 7. This dataset was selected and generated through NASA's Commercial Remote Sensing Program, as part of a cooperative effort between NASA and the commercial remote sensing community to provide users with access to quality-screened, high-resolution satellite images with global coverage over the Earth's land masses. The data collection was compiled via NASA contract with Earth Satellite Corporation (Rockville, MD) in association with NASA's Scientific Data Purchase program. The Tri-Decadal Global Landsat Orthorectified data collection consists of approximately 7,500 MSS (Landsat 1-5) images, 7,461 TM (Landsat 4-5) images and approximately 8,500 ETM+ (Landsat 7) images, which were selected to provide three full sets of global coverage over an approximate 25-year interval (circa 1975, circa 1990 and circa 2000). All selected images were either cloud-free or contained minimal cloud cover. In addition, only images with a high quality ranking in regards to the possible presence of errors such as missing scans or saturated bands were selected. Back to TopGlobal Land SurveyIn the past, the U.S. Geological Survey (USGS) and the National Aeronautics and Space Administration (NASA) collaborated on the creation of three global land data sets from Landsat data: one from the 1970s, and one each from circa 1990 and 2000. Each of these global data sets was created from the primary Landsat sensor in use at the time: the Multispectral Scanner in the 1970s, the Thematic Mapper (TM) in 1990, and Enhanced Thematic Mapper Plus (ETM+) in 2000. To extend this multi-decadal Landsat data collection, NASA and the USGS have again partnered to develop the Mid-Decadal Global Land Survey (MDGLS), a new global land data set with core acquisition dates of 2005-2006. The data to be included will consist of both Landsat TM and ETM+ imagery, making MDGLS the first-ever global data set built with data from two sensors. Direct downlink to a ground station is the only way to acquire Landsat 5 TM data, because unlike Landsat 7, the Landsat 5 satellite does not have an onboard solid-state recorder. To obtain Landsat 5 TM imagery for areas outside the United States, the USGS negotiated agreements with ground stations around the globe to downlink and send data to the USGS Landsat Ground Station. These agreements make thousands of additional Landsat 5 TM scenes available for MDGLS consideration. The USGS Landsat Ground Station archives nearly 100,000 new Landsat 7 ETM+ images every year. These images are a record of nearly all the land area on Earth. The Landsat 7 ETM+ and Landsat 5 TM data incorporated into the MGDLS dataset must meet quality and cloud cover standards. Data recorded in 2004 and 2007 will be used only as needed to fill areas of low image quality or excessive cloud cover. Landsat 7 ETM+ scenes from the Mid-Decadal Global Land Survey will be available beginning in late 2007. The MDGLS data set will be only scene-based (other decadal datasets also included mosaics), and individual scenes will be made available as they are processed. The average acquisition date for the GLS 2005 is 2005 (+/- 3 years). All scenes were acquired between 2004 and 2007. The GLS 2000 data was used to correct this dataset. GLS 2005 will continue to grow as we complete this collection.

Tri-Decadal Global Landsat Orthorectified MSS, TM and ETM+ data can be searched and ordered from GloVis and EarthExplorer. Tri-Decadal Global Landsat Orthorectified MSS, TM and ETM+ data are also available for download from the above Web sites, in a compressed and tarred format. Users are recommended to download only one scene per session. If higher quantities are needed, order on media at a nominal cost. Note: The full Tri-Decadal Global Landsat Orthorectified data collection selection consisted of approximately 7,500 MSS (Landsat 1-5), 7,461 TM (Landsat 4-5) and 8,500 ETM+ (Landsat 7) images. However, not all of these images are currently available for search and order from EROS at this time. Users will need to run a search to determine the scene availability for any given location.
